The following trail report was released by the Whitehorse Nordic Centre Thursday:

More fresh snow is great news for cross country skiers.

Copper, Dog, Selwyn's Loop, the World Cup 5 km and the Stadium were groomed by the PistenBully Thursday morning after the snow ended and are excellent for classic and skating.

With these mild temperatures, a nighttime ski is a great idea. Trail lights are on until 9:30 p.m. on weeknights.

A safety reminder for all skiers skiing one-way trails to be sure to follow the direction recommended on trails such as Pierre Harvey.

For skiers with dogs, owners are reminded that dogs must be under control at all times on the trails.

Day passes or ski club memberships are required to use the Whitehorse Nordic Centre trails and are available at the Ski Base.

Notice for all trail users: please wear season/day passes.

Trail maps are available at the Ski Chalet entrance, Visitor Centre, Icycle Sport and Coast Mountain Sports.

Wax suggestions: Rode Super Blue. Wax room hours are Monday to Friday, 9 a.m. to 10 p.m.; Saturday and Sunday, 9 a.m. to 6 p.m.

Events and program information: timing workshop on Dec. 17. Get involved with the ski race timing team; Don Sumanik Race No. 1 runs Saturday, Dec. 22; adult lessons are offered by Aurora Ski School, Performance Ski School and Stride and Glide.
